黑狐家游戏

深入解析前台网站系统源码,架构、技术与优化策略,前台网站系统源码怎么找

欧气 0 0

本文目录导读:

  1. 前台网站系统架构
  2. 技术实现
  3. 优化策略

随着互联网技术的飞速发展,越来越多的企业开始关注自身的前台网站系统,一个优秀的网站系统不仅能提升企业形象,还能提高用户体验,为企业带来更多的商机,本文将深入解析前台网站系统源码,从架构、技术、优化策略等方面进行详细阐述,希望能为广大开发者提供有益的参考。

前台网站系统架构

1、系统分层

一个完整的前台网站系统通常分为以下几层:

深入解析前台网站系统源码,架构、技术与优化策略,前台网站系统源码怎么找

图片来源于网络,如有侵权联系删除

(1)表现层:负责展示网站内容,与用户直接交互,主要包括HTML、CSS、JavaScript等前端技术。

(2)业务逻辑层:负责处理用户请求,执行业务逻辑,主要包括后端语言(如Java、PHP、Python等)和数据库操作。

(3)数据访问层:负责与数据库进行交互,获取和存储数据,主要包括数据库(如MySQL、Oracle、MongoDB等)和ORM(对象关系映射)框架。

(4)服务层:负责将业务逻辑层的数据转换为表现层所需的数据格式,实现前后端的分离,主要包括API接口、中间件等。

2、技术选型

(1)前端技术:HTML5、CSS3、JavaScript、Vue.js、React、Angular等。

(2)后端技术:Java、PHP、Python、Node.js等。

(3)数据库:MySQL、Oracle、MongoDB等。

(4)缓存:Redis、Memcached等。

(5)框架:Spring Boot、Laravel、Django、Express等。

技术实现

1、前端技术实现

深入解析前台网站系统源码,架构、技术与优化策略,前台网站系统源码怎么找

图片来源于网络,如有侵权联系删除

(1)HTML5:使用HTML5标签实现页面布局,提高页面兼容性。

(2)CSS3:使用CSS3样式实现页面美观和动画效果。

(3)JavaScript:使用JavaScript实现页面交互和动态效果。

(4)Vue.js/React/Angular:使用前端框架实现组件化和模块化开发,提高开发效率。

2、后端技术实现

(1)Java/PHP/Python/Node.js:选择合适的服务器端语言,实现业务逻辑。

(2)数据库:根据业务需求选择合适的数据库,并使用ORM框架简化数据库操作。

(3)缓存:使用Redis、Memcached等缓存技术,提高系统性能。

(4)框架:使用Spring Boot、Laravel、Django、Express等框架,简化开发过程。

优化策略

1、前端优化

(1)代码压缩与合并:对CSS、JavaScript等文件进行压缩和合并,减少HTTP请求。

深入解析前台网站系统源码,架构、技术与优化策略,前台网站系统源码怎么找

图片来源于网络,如有侵权联系删除

(2)图片优化:对图片进行压缩,减小图片体积。

(3)懒加载:对非关键资源进行懒加载,提高页面加载速度。

(4)CDN加速:使用CDN加速,提高用户访问速度。

2、后端优化

(1)数据库优化:对数据库进行索引优化、分区优化等,提高查询效率。

(2)缓存优化:合理配置缓存策略,减少数据库访问次数。

(3)负载均衡:使用负载均衡技术,提高系统并发能力。

(4)服务器优化:优化服务器配置,提高服务器性能。

通过对前台网站系统源码的深入解析,本文从架构、技术、优化策略等方面进行了详细阐述,希望本文能为广大开发者提供有益的参考,助力企业打造高效、稳定、易用的前台网站系统。

标签: #前台网站系统源码

黑狐家游戏
  • 评论列表

留言评论